The Nokia 6300 is your classic Nokia - in fact, it's a classic phone, brand aside! If you're not fussed about fancy-extras - you don't want to be connected to the Internet 24/7 (there's no stumbling across work emails in the weekend or becoming a Facebook addict with this one - you actually have time for YOU) you have a digital camera for taking pictures, and you can take the sneering looks and gadget-brags from smug iPhone/Blackberry/Android types, then this is the phone for you!

It's a welcome relief to have a phone that does just that - phone! Mind you, it's great for texting too - no insensitive touchscreens here. It's old school - in a cool 'Check out my phone? I'm not a sheep/slave to trends, see!' kind of way - and not only that but you've got a few hundred quid in your back pocket if you choose the Nokia 6300 - why not go on holiday!

In terms of build quality, it's battery life is pretty good - certainly much better than my iPhone (my work phone) and it's SO strong and sturdy - built to last instead of built to con you into forking out for a hefty phone insurance plan... and then the insurance excess every time you so much as glance and the screen while frowning! I have dropped this, hurled it across the room even, a hundred times - not so much as a cracked screen - and barely a scratch on the paintwork!
P.s. I used to lose phones/have them stolen ALL the time... not this one, no one wants to steal it so my phone (and my hard earned cash!) are safe. Brilliant.

I have had many phones, and my Nokia is one of the cheapest, but its still my favourite. The camera is good and the phone can store 4GB memory card without any lagging. As well as this the phone is so easy to use, with its simple layout, bright screen and stylish keypad. I was extremely impressed with the quality of the speakers, and the headphones that were provided with the phone, was impressive. Also the battery life is alright, and does not need charging that often. This is a fantastic mobile phone that anyone can use, and I would highly recommend it.

Great little phone, easy to use and really hard wearing. Easy to clean and no annoying little bits to get broken. Easy to get replacement parts for and mine is still going strong after 3 years.

Highly recommended as a practical and hardwearing phone. Nice looking and just the right size for daily use, won't get lost in your handbag but will fit nicely in your pocket!! Camera is not up to todays spec but will take a decent photo and has good memory.

I've had this phone for 6 months now and it is distinctly average. The camera is ok, but nothing special. The phone does what you would expect of a simple Nokia phone and nothing more. There are very few applications available for it and little scope for customisation. Great for making basic calls and texts but not much else.
